MotherGoose, my last photo was taken at Hall's Gap in The Grampians National Park. We stayed at the YHA, an eco-designed building along the main road. Very pleasant but inexpensive accommodation, kangaroos grazing on the lawn, free-range chooks pecking about, pick your own herbs to use in the communal kitchen.
I'm not too happy with my photo results, but will post some over the next few days.
